The thirteenth word of verse (5:110) is divided into 3 morphological segments. A verb, subject pronoun and object pronoun. The form II perfect verb (فعل ماض) is first person singular. The verb's triliteral root is hamza yā dāl (أ ي د). The suffix (التاء) is an attached subject pronoun. The attached object pronoun is second person masculine singular.
